43 CHATSWORTH ROAD is a large extended detached house of 161m², built sometime between 1930 and 1949, which could now be worth an estimated £410,544. It was last sold for £240,000 in March 2010, which was around 26% below the average March 2010 detached price in the Bournemouth Christchurch and Poole local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2009, where the current energy rating was E, and the potential energy rating was D.

What might 43 CHATSWORTH ROAD be worth now?

43 CHATSWORTH ROAD might now be worth an estimated £410,544.

This is based on house price inflation of 71.1%, between March 2010 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Bournemouth Christchurch and Poole local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 71.1%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 43 CHATSWORTH ROAD of £240,000 on 12th March 2010. For the value to have increased from £240,000 to £410,544 over the fifteen years and one month to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 43 CHATSWORTH ROAD has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Bournemouth Christchurch and Poole local authority area.
  • The March 2010 sale price of £240,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 43 CHATSWORTH ROAD has not materially changed since March 2010.
